Baylor Soccer Falls to Kansas State, 2-1
Vargas nets her third goal in two games
For more information contact: Katy Gilmore, 254-252-2182, katy_gilmore at baylor.edu<mailto:katy_gilmore at baylor.edu>

WACO, Texas – Baylor soccer falls in the final seconds to Kansas State, 2-1, Sunday afternoon at Betty Lou Mays Field.

The Bears who are now 3-7-2 on the season, 1-3-0 in conference play, scored the equalizer in the second half before narrowly falling to the Wildcats.

THE RUNDOWN
Baylor started the match strong, with defender Ava Colberg putting a shot on frame in the second minute. By the fifth minute, Baylor had already taken two corners put weren’t able to capitalize off of set pieces.

Ashley Merrill lined up a shot in the 11th minute that had potential but bounced off of the top woodwork.

In total, Baylor took seven corners in the first half, creating chances but not able to find the back of the net on any of them.

The Wildcats scored their first goal in the 30th minute and held the 1-0 lead into halftime.

After the break, Jenna Patterson lined up a good look, but the KSU goalkeeper made the stop. Elizabeth Kooiman also took a shot but it ricocheted off the crossbar.

In the 53rd minute, Reneta Vargas, who started in her second-straight game of the week was able to find the back of the net for the third time in two games. With an assist off of the boot of Hannah Augustyn, Vargas headed the ball into the back of the net and evened the score at 1-1.

Goalkeeper Lauren Traywick tallied seven saves in the match, including three almost back-to-back-to-back saves in the second half, one in which she made a diving stop.

BU only put one more shot on goal for the remainder of the game, as Maddie Algya and Micah Beasley each had shots that sailed just high of the net.

The Wildcats scored their winning goal with 18 seconds left on the clock after a penalty in the box was called on the Bears and KSU lined up for a penalty kick.

QUOTABLE
Michelle Lenard on the game …
“That’s disappointing, for sure. For us to come out on Thursday and play the way that we did, and respond the way that we did going down. I thought we came out sluggish and tired, and maybe that’s a little bit of carryover from Thursday, so much excitement and energy used in that game. Despite that, I thought we played well enough to certainly not lose in the last 30 seconds on what looked like a pretty questionable call to me. I didn’t think there was enough there to determine a game on that. So, that’s frustrating. And unfortunately, that’s about all I can think about at the moment. I told the players, we don’t want to be in that situation where the game can come down to a call in the last 30 seconds of the game. We needed to be sharper with the chances we did have. Again, controlled more of the ball, we were vulnerable in counter attacks. That’s all they looked to do the whole game, win and kick it, win and kick it. But, we had chances, we were in the attacking third and we lacked the execution in the box today that we had on Thursday. And when you do that, sometimes you end up in these tough situations that sometimes go that way.”
